Public broadcasting and national media

Strategic Profile

The CBC's operations are financed through advertising sales and primarily annual appropriations from Parliament. In 2023, 66.7% of CBC's revenue came from parliamentary spending. Over the long term, TV advertising revenue is decreasing as a proportion of total source of funds, mainly due to the market's shift to digital advertising platforms. The organization faces structural challenges in an evolving media landscape while maintaining public service commitments across traditional and digital platforms.

Cyborg Score Rationale

In 2024, CBC/Radio-Canada generated around 493.5 million Canadian dollars in revenue, down by over four percent from 2023. The Canadian Broadcasting Corporation is facing a long-term structural deficit that negatively impacts its service offerings. While CBC maintains strong content and audience reach, it struggles with declining revenue, shifting media consumption, and funding dependency on government appropriations without multi-year agreements.

Recent Developments

  • (December 2025) Renewed three-year partnership with Australian Broadcasting Corporation for documentary and natural history content
  • (2024) Annual revenue totaled $493.5 million CAD, representing a 4% decline year-over-year
  • (May 2024) Canadian Heritage minister launched advisory committee to modernize CBC/Radio-Canada's mandate, governance, and funding structure
